realtek: rtl930x: Add support for Plasma Cloud MCX3 Media Converter
The Plasma Cloud MCX3 Media Converter is a 3 port multi-GBit switch with 2x 10/100/1000/2500BaseT Ethernet ports and 1x SFP+ module slot. Hardware: - RTL9302C SoC - Macronix MX25L25645G (32MB flash) - Winbond W632GU6rB-11 (256MB DDR3 SDRAM) - RTL8224 4x 10m/100m/1/2.5 Gigabit PHY - IC+ IP802AR POE+ PSE controller The media converter is powered by 54 Volts 1.2A barrel connector. The internal TTL serial connector can be used to access the terminal. Pins from 1: TX RX (unused) GND. Serial connection is via 115200 baud, 8N1. A reset button is accessible through a hole next to the SFP+ module slot. Installation ------------ * The device can be flashed by using sysupgrade command. Either from the original vendor firmware or using an initramfs (see "Debug") * Connect serial as per the layout above. Connection parameters: 115200 8N1 * The image must be copied using scp to /tmp of the device scp openwrt-realtek-rtl930x-plasmacloud_mcx3-squashfs-sysupgrade.bin root@[IP address of the device]:/tmp/ * start sysupgrade without saving the original vendor configuration sysupgrade -n /tmp/openwrt-realtek-rtl930x-plasmacloud_mcx3-squashfs-sysupgrade.bin Installation via u-boot ----------------------- If you have an TFTP server connected to the switch, it is possible to directly install the device using the factory image from u-boot # setup networking and IP of TFP server rtk network on setenv ipaddr 10.100.100.99 setenv serverip 10.100.100.20 # get factory image tftp 0x84000000 factory.bin # erase firmware partitions sf probe 0 sf erase 0x100000 0x01f00000 # write firmware to both partitions sf write ${fileaddr} 0x100000 ${filesize} sf write ${fileaddr} 0x1080000 ${filesize} # adjust the boot commands setenv bootargs "mtdparts=spi0.0:896k(u-boot),64k(u-boot-env),64k(u-boot-env2),15872k(inactive),15872k(firmware2)" setenv bootcmd "rtk init; bootm 0xb5080000" # restart reset Debug ----- * Connect serial as per the layout above. Connection parameters: 115200 8N1. * A tftp server is required, tftpd-hpa works well. * Power the device, at U-Boot start rapidly hit Esc key to stop autoboot * Enable network: rtk network on * Change ip address of device: setenv ipaddr 192.168.1.6 * Download initramfs from TFTP server: tftpboot 0x84000000 192.168.1.111:openwrt-realtek-rtl930x-plasmacloud_mcx3-initramfs-kernel.bin * Boot loaded file: bootm 0x84000000 Signed-off-by: Harshal Gohel <hg@simonwunderlich.de> Signed-off-by: Sven Eckelmann <se@simonwunderlich.de> Link: https://github.com/openwrt/openwrt/pull/20625 Signed-off-by: Robert Marko <robimarko@gmail.com>
